Abstract
A method and system for use in determining the position of a mobile terminal in a CDMA mobile communications system is disclosed, whereby a different than usual spreading code is used when TOA measurements are being performed, but information is allowed to be transmitted while those TOA measurements are being performed. In one embodiment, the length of the different spreading codes used is equal to one symbol length. In a second embodiment, a mobile terminal uses a long spreading code and short spreading code prior to making TOA measurements. When TOA measurements are to be made, the serving base station orders the mobile terminal to change the spreading code by terminating the use of the long code and continuing use of the short code. Alternatively, when the TOA measurements are to be made, the serving base station orders the mobile terminal to substitute a second, predetermined short code for the long code being used, and to continue use of the first short code. The TOA measurements are then performed in at least three base stations, and the position of the mobile terminal is derived from this TOA information.
